Excel表格网

轻松掌握SQL中的SUM函数,统计多个字段秒变高手

252 2025-02-08 06:50 admin   手机版

在数据分析的过程中,我们常常需要对多个字段求和,尤其是在使用SQL进行数据库查询时,SUM函数是一个不可或缺的重要工具。今天,我想和大家聊聊如何在SQL中利用SUM函数来统计多个字段,帮助你提升数据处理的效率。

SUM函数的基本用法

在SQL中,SUM函数是用来计算一个或多个数字字段的总和。最基本的语法结构如下:

SELECT SUM(column_name) 
FROM table_name 
WHERE condition;

这里,column_name是你想要统计的字段,table_name是数据表的名称,condition是你希望筛选数据的条件。如果你直接查询一个字段的和,结果将非常简单。

如何统计多个字段?

然而,实际情况常常会复杂一些,我们可能需要同时统计多个字段的总和。在这种情况下,我们可以在同一查询中使用多个SUM函数。示例如下:

SELECT SUM(column1) AS total_column1, 
       SUM(column2) AS total_column2 
FROM table_name 
WHERE condition;

在这个例子中,total_column1total_column2分别是两个字段的总和。你可以通过在SELECT语句中加入多个SUM函数,轻松得到多个字段的和。

案例演示

假设我们有一张名为sales的表,里面记录了每个月的销售额和成本,包括revenuecost两个字段。我们想要计算当月的总销售额和总成本。下面是对应的SQL查询:

SELECT SUM(revenue) AS total_revenue, 
       SUM(cost) AS total_cost 
FROM sales 
WHERE month = '2023-10';

执行这条查询后,我们将得到2023年10月的总销售额和总成本。这样,你就可以简单地了解当月的盈利情况。

注意事项

  • 确保在使用SUM函数时没有漏掉任何需要统计的字段,避免数据遗漏。
  • 如果要进行复杂的统计分析,可以结合GROUP BY语句,按特定字段进行分组。
  • 注意对NULL值的处理,通常情况下,NULL值在求和时会被忽略,但最好在数据预处理时就进行清理。

扩展话题:数据分析工具的选择

除了使用SQL求和,我们还可以借助一些数据分析工具来简化工作。例如,Excel中的数据透视表也可以快速实现对多个字段的求和统计。甚至在Python中使用Pandas库,可以方便地处理更大规模的数据集。

总之,无论何种工具,掌握了SUM函数及其用法,我们都可以轻松应对数据统计的各种挑战,让我们在数据分析的路上走得更加顺畅。

顶一下
(0)
0.00%
踩一下
(0)
0.00%
相关评论
我要评论
用户名: 验证码:点击我更换图片
253